Hi there, @JRadecki.

 

I've moved your post to the Fitbit.com Dashboard board so we can keep the forums organized. Thanks for bringing this to our attention, and the picture provided. Let me explain that in order to ensure that your personal private information stays secure, the Community Forum does not allow series of numbers that can be taken as telephone numbers, even if they're in pictures. I you receive this error, please remove that content from your post and try again.
